About St. Pius X St. Matthias Academy

St. Pius X St. Matthias Academy is a private high school in Downey, CA 90242.

The school serves approximately 591 students in grades 9th –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 19.1: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$83,238, where 24%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

Why doesn't this school have a score?

We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in CA a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.

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.

Community Profile

The community surrounding St. Pius X St. Matthias Academy has a median household income of $83,238. It is a community where 24%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$676,100, with a median rent of $1,874/month. The local poverty rate of 9.3%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 30 minutes.
